The Schnalstaler Gletscherbahn is the highest cable car in South Tyrol. The cable car opens Hochjochferner in the Oetztal Alps and leads from Maso Corto (2,011 m asl) to the mountain station (3,212 m asl) just below the Grawand. The 1,201 meters of vertical drop is overcome in six minutes driving time.
